This CD is full of errie beats and spacious rhymes. | |
| Young Bleed has a unique talent for flowing to any beat. His southern beats accompany his errie voice well. Some of the tracks are exceptional, while others just the opposite. This is the type of release that grows on you, chances are the more you listen to it, the more you appreciate it. His style is not for everyone, but he has a talent for writing songs that flow incredibly well at times. "How Ya Do Dat" is a great party song, while "The Day Dey Make Me Boss" is a trip into the mind of Young Bleed. There is a little bit of something for everyone on this CD, yet not versitile for everyone's taste. If you like hard rap with a soothing voice, take a look at this (in my opinion) great release. | |
